[Suncheon=Asia Economy Honam Reporting Headquarters Reporter Lee Hyung-kwon] Sangsa-myeon, Suncheon-si, Jeollanam-do, announced on the 19th that on the 17th, under the slogan "Suncheon Ecological Axis Dongcheon, Blossoming at Isacheon," which wishes for the Isacheon Yeonga (connection between Dongcheon and Isacheon), a dialogue with citizens was held together with Mayor Heo Seok of Suncheon.


As it had been nearly two years since direct communication with citizens was difficult due to COVID-19, this dialogue with citizens, conducted in a conversational format with questions and answers in a free atmosphere, was more enthusiastic than ever.


The residents of Sangsa-myeon presented various opinions ranging from civil complaints directly related to daily life, such as ▲expansion and paving of rural roads, ▲request for wastewater treatment facilities in Ogok Village, ▲installation of water supply in Seodong Village, and ▲creation of Isacheon Sports Park, to opinions related to regional issues.


Mayor Heo Seok of Suncheon said, "I am glad to have a valuable opportunity to communicate with citizens on-site along with the phased recovery of daily life," and added, "We will do our best to actively reflect the contents suggested by the residents of Sangsa-myeon in the city administration."



He continued, "We will promote the connection of the disconnected sections between Dongcheon and Isacheon while preserving the natural environment of Isacheon," and also formed a consensus on the necessity of establishing a systematic development plan for Isacheon Yeonga.
